Director, Acquisitions

Dallas, TX

JOB DESCRIPTION

Company Overview:
A U.S.-based, vertically integrated real estate investment, development, and asset management firm that acquires, redevelops, and manages a diverse portfolio of real estate assets nationwide. The firm also manages private real estate funds and credit vehicles, enabling it to deploy both equity and debt capital across market cycles.

Its platform is active across residential, retail, mixed-use, land development, hospitality, and industrial properties, with a track record of repositioning complex assets and creating long-term value through disciplined investment and hands-on management. The company operates with institutional standards and entrepreneurial agility—overseeing the full investment lifecycle from acquisition and capitalization through development, leasing, and asset performance.

Position Description:
Our client is seeking a highly motivated Director of Acquisitions to identify, evaluate, negotiate, and execute commercial real estate investments. This is a hands-on role responsible for sourcing new opportunities, performing and reviewing financial underwriting, leading due diligence, and managing transactions from initial evaluation through closing. The Director will work closely with senior leadership while also partnering with analysts and cross-functional teams to move investments from concept to execution.
 
The ideal candidate combines strong analytical and financial modeling skills with exceptional relationship-building abilities and thrives in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ment where curiosity, creativity, sound investment judgment, and a willingness to roll up their sleeves are highly valued.
 

Primary Responsibilities:
Investment Origination

  • Develop and maintain relationships with brokers, owners, lenders, developers, operators, and industry professionals.
  • Proactively source both marketed and off-market investment opportunities.
  • Build and maintain an active pipeline across multiple markets and asset classes.
  • Attend industry events and cultivate new business relationships.
  • Identify emerging market trends and investment opportunities that align with our client's strategy

Financial Analysis & Underwriting

  • Personally build, review, and refine complex acquisition and development financial models.
  • Analyze operating statements, rent rolls, market data, capital structures, and business plans.
  • Evaluate investment returns, sensitivities, downside risks, and financing alternatives.
  • Prepare investment memorandums and present recommendations to executive leadership and the Investment Committee.
  • Work alongside analysts by reviewing assumptions, providing guidance, and ensuring underwriting accuracy.

Due Diligence

  • Lead and actively participate in all phases of acquisition due diligence.
  • Review leases, operating reports, third-party reports, legal documents, and property-level information.
  • Coordinate legal, environmental, engineering, survey, title, insurance, tax, and other consultants.
  • Identify transaction risks and develop practical mitigation strategies.
  • Partner closely with development, construction, accounting, asset management, and property management teams throughout the diligence process.

Transaction Execution

  • Participate directly in negotiating letters of intent, purchase agreements, amendments, and transaction documents.
  • Coordinate lenders, attorneys, title companies, consultants, and equity partners through closing.
  • Manage transaction timelines, resolve issues as they arise, and ensure critical milestones are achieved.
  • Support financing efforts, capital partner communications, and closing activities as needed.

Portfolio & Strategic Analysis

  • Evaluate existing investments for refinancing, recapitalization, repositioning, or disposition opportunities.
  • Perform hold-versus-sell analyses and other strategic evaluations.
  • Monitor market conditions, cap rates, financing trends, construction costs, and competitive activity.
  • Contribute to long-term acquisition strategy, geographic expansion, and new investment initiatives.
